Elvis got his success thanks to timing I think.
That's all.
One lucky guy in the right place at the right time.
Popular music was changing.
Social attitudes to young folk were changing.
Radio was changing.
Music listening equipment at home was changing.
Television was in it's heyday.
Like I say. One very lucky guy !
Berry ? Well, he's certainly the jukebox king !
Producers; radio managers; promoters all liked Berry because he could produce the perfect 2minute 30second jukebox tune !
Which made them all a lot of money !!
As an artist ? Not bad singer. Good performer. Pretty good writer too.
